
The meeting lasted 1 hour and 40 minutes, exceeding the scheduled time in Trump's agenda. As of now, neither leader has made official statements following the conclusion of the negotiations.
According to information provided by CNN, this was the first in-person meeting between the two leaders in the past six years, and they exchanged positive remarks.
Trump noted that Xi Jinping is a "great leader of a great country" and expressed confidence that their relationship will be "fantastic for a long time." In turn, Xi emphasized that he was "pleased" to see Trump again after such a long time.
The Chinese leader also pointed out that "their views do not always align," which is normal for the two leading economies in the world, adding that they must "follow the right course" in managing Sino-American relations. Xi expressed hope that both countries can "prosper together."
He also highlighted that China's development does not contradict Trump's goal of "making America great again."
Xi added that the trade and economic teams of both countries have reached preliminary agreements on key issues of concern and achieved positive results. "History teaches us that China and the U.S. should be partners and friends," he stated.
After exchanging views, Trump and Xi continued the negotiations in a closed format. The American delegation included Secretary of State Marco Rubio, Trade Representative Jamison Greer, Treasury Secretary Scott Bessent, Commerce Secretary Howard Latnik, Chief of Staff Suzy Wiles, and U.S. Ambassador to China David Purdue.
The Chinese side was represented by Foreign Minister Wang Yi, his deputy Ma Zhaoxu, Vice Premier of the State Council He Lifeng, Chief of Staff Cai Qi, Commerce Minister Wang Wentao, and Chairman of the National Development and Reform Commission Zheng Shanjie.
The Chinese Ministry of Foreign Affairs reported that the main topics of discussion were the development of bilateral relations, common interests, and the situation in Ukraine.
